Best Outdoor Activities in Spokane for Adventure Enthusiasts

For those in search of adventure, Spokane provides a wide range of outdoor pursuits that cater to thrill-seekers and nature enthusiasts alike. The scenic Spokane River provides opportunities for kayaking and white-water rafting, attracting those craving excitement on the water. Just beyond, the sweeping terrain of Riverside State Park offer remarkable trails for hiking and mountain biking, displaying breathtaking views of the natural surroundings.

During the winter season, the adjacent mountains transform into a playground for snowboarding and skiing, bringing in winter sports lovers from all around. Rock climbers can navigate the varied cliffs at the adjacent Beacon Hill, while fishermen can enjoy casting lines in the area's crystal-clear lakes and rivers. Furthermore, the lush forests bordering Spokane are perfect for wildlife watching and camping. With so many exciting choices, Spokane emerges as an outdoor enthusiast's paradise, inviting adventure seekers to experience its natural beauty and exhilarating experiences.

Explore Spokane's Cultural Gems

Spokane features a remarkable array of cultural treasures that enchant tourists and locals alike. The area's vibrant arts scene is distinguished by the Spokane Art School and a wide variety of galleries displaying local talent. The historic downtown area boasts the iconic Fox Theater, a beautifully restored venue that presents a range of performances, from Broadway shows to concerts.

The Northwest Museum of Arts and Culture serves as a focal point for regional history and indigenous heritage, featuring illuminating exhibits that showcase the area's rich history. Additionally, the Spokane Symphony elevates the cultural landscape with its compelling performances year-round, appealing to music aficionados from all walks of life.

In addition, the annual Spokane International Film Festival presents independent cinema, cultivating a love for cinema in the local community. Together, these cultural gems embody Spokane's vibrant artistic spirit, making it a premier destination for those eager to explore the area's history and heritage.

Best Family Attractions to Discover in Spokane

When families seek adventure and fun, Spokane offers a plethora of attractions that appeal to every age group. One of the standout destinations is Riverfront Park, where kids can delight in a splash pad, playgrounds, and the beloved gondola ride over the Spokane Falls. The park features plenty of space for picnics and outdoor activities, making it an ideal destination for families.

Another great stop is the renowned Spokane Children's Museum, which provides interactive exhibits designed to engage children through practical discovery. For those who love animals, the Spokane Zoo located at Riverfront Park showcases a broad selection of species and provides informative programs to cultivate an appreciation for wildlife.

Families can also explore the Mobius Science Center, where science comes to life through engaging displays and experiments. These destinations promise that families who visit Spokane create lasting memories filled with laughter and exploration.

Seasonal Events and Festivals in Spokane

Dynamic events characterize Spokane's beloved festive seasonal occasions, attracting both locals and visitors alike. Every season presents distinct opportunities, showcasing the city's rich heritage and community bonds. Spring announces the celebrated Lilac Festival, an event showcasing colorful floral arrangements, a spectacular parade, and engaging family activities. Summertime welcomes the popular Spokane County Interstate Fair, where attendees enjoy exciting attractions, fun-filled games, and local food stalls complemented by live entertainment.

When fall sets in, the city hosts the popular Spokane Oktoberfest, mixing classic German traditions with regional craft beers and hearty food offerings. Winter converts Spokane into a seasonal wonderland with the yearly Holiday Tree Lighting Ceremony, brightening Riverfront Park and igniting the festive spirit.

These events not only highlight Spokane's rich heritage but also strengthen bonds between residents and visitors, establishing the city as a vibrant destination for activity all year long. Each festival offers a memorable experience, inviting everyone to partake in the joyful atmosphere.

Tips for Navigating Spokane Like a Local

How can visitors genuinely discover Spokane from a local's perspective? To navigate this vibrant city, a few tips can enhance the experience. One great starting point is taking advantage of the Spokane Transit Authority's bus routes, which provide a budget-friendly way to visit numerous neighborhoods, such as the fashionable South Hill district and the storied downtown corridor. Additionally, walking or biking along the Centennial Trail offers a scenic view of the Spokane River and surrounding parks.

Neighborhood restaurants consistently deliver outstanding gastronomic adventures. Recommendations include trying the diverse menu at The Wandering Table or indulging in specialty drinks at a nearby café. Participating in neighborhood activities, such as weekend markets and cultural walks, can also offer a glimpse of community culture.

Finally connecting with community members through social media groups or community boards can reveal hidden gems and insider tips. With these strategies, guests can experience Spokane's unique charm and lifestyle, creating a more authentic experience.
